+ %{?python_enable_dependency_generator}

+ %bcond_without check

+ 

+ %global modname pynacl

+ 

+ Name:           python-%{modname}

+ Version:        1.4.0

+ Release:        5%{?dist}

+ Summary:        Python binding to the Networking and Cryptography (NaCl) library

+ 

+ License:        ASL 2.0

+ URL:            https://github.com/pyca/pynacl

+ Source0:        %{url}/archive/%{version}/%{modname}-%{version}.tar.gz

+ 

+ # remove spurious wheel dependency

+ Patch1:         %{url}/pull/596.patch

+ 

+ BuildRequires:  gcc

+ BuildRequires:  libsodium-devel

+ 

+ %global _description \

+ PyNaCl is a Python binding to the Networking and Cryptography library,\

+ a crypto library with the stated goal of improving usability, security\

+ and speed.

+ 

+ %description %{_description}

+ 

+ %package -n python3-%{modname}

+ Summary:        %{summary}

+ %{?python_provide:%python_provide python3-%{modname}}

+ BuildRequires:  python3-devel

+ BuildRequires:  python3-setuptools

+ BuildRequires:  python3-cffi >= 1.4.1

+ %if %{with check}

+ BuildRequires:  python3-six

+ BuildRequires:  python3-pytest >= 3.2.1

+ BuildRequires:  python3-hypothesis >= 3.27.0

+ %endif

+ 

+ %description -n python3-%{modname} %{_description}

+ 

+ Python 3 version.

+ 

+ %prep

+ %autosetup -p1 -n %{modname}-%{version}

+ # Remove bundled libsodium, to be sure

+ rm -vrf src/libsodium/

+ 

+ # ARM and s390x is too slow for upstream tests

+ # See https://bugzilla.redhat.com/show_bug.cgi?id=1594901

+ # And https://github.com/pyca/pynacl/issues/370

+ %ifarch s390x %{arm}

+ sed -i 's/@settings(deadline=1500, max_examples=5)/@settings(deadline=4000, max_examples=5)/' tests/test_pwhash.py

+ %endif

+ 

+ %build

+ export SODIUM_INSTALL=system

+ %py3_build

+ 

+ %install

+ %py3_install

+ 

+ %if %{with check}

+ %check

+ PYTHONPATH=%{buildroot}%{python3_sitearch} py.test-3 -v

+ %endif

+ 

+ %files -n python3-%{modname}

+ %license LICENSE

+ %doc README.rst

+ %{python3_sitearch}/PyNaCl-*.egg-info/

+ %{python3_sitearch}/nacl/

+
